I am still nursing my 17 month old daughter and am 21 weeks pregnant.  My milk production has gone way down, and I think she only does it for comfort.

 

Anyway, I think something has changed in the way she suckles... it almost feels like biting when she latches on (I'm pretty sure she's not because her tongue comes out a little).  I have had psoriasis (very mild) almost as long as I can remember, and before I got pregnant again, her breastfeeding rarely caused any breakouts on my breasts, but now it's a different story.

 

I am not interested in weaning at all, and I'm not trying to be a martyr here.  I just want to do what is best for both of us.  I don't have any La Leche groups around here, and I was hoping that some of you might have experienced this painful experience and might have some advice.  It would be greatly appreciated.

I don't have any answers, but I'm 31 weeks, and my 19 month old has been latching differently since she stopped getting much milk. and it's really painful sometimes. I think it's that she isn't sucking to get milk anymore, she's just sucking. so she's using a completely different mechanic.

DD's suck also changed when my milk dried up.  She was a bit older, but I would tell her that her teeth were hurting and ask her to adjust her suck.  It would feel better for a few minutes and then we would have to adjust again.
